## Deployment

The Wayfinder deep-link router ships as a single container behind the Hollowgate edge proxy. Deploys are blue-green: the new revision takes shadow traffic for ten minutes before the cutover, and route tables are validated against the link manifest during that window. Rollback is a one-command flip, so prefer rolling back over hotfixing during the sync window. Mismatched manifests are the most common failure, so diff them first. Each deployed revision must ship with the following configuration values:

settings of fafog-haduf:
ZORIX_PIN=4648
ZORIX_METRICS_HOST=metrics.zorix.paliqsys.corp
ZORIX_LOG_LEVEL=info
ZORIX_TENANT=druix

Adds Sweepling, the stale-branch cleanup bot for the Oakmarsh monorepo. Scans nightly, flags branches with no commits past the threshold, comments once, waits, then deletes. Protected branches and anything matching the release glob are skipped. Dry-run mode is on by default; flip it in config after you've reviewed one cycle of output. No webhook changes needed. Rollback is just disabling the cron entry. Current thresholds are set as follows.

tuning table, kajog-bawip:
TIERS = {
    "kelius": 256,
    "lammir": 543,
}

14:22 — Telemetry gateway for the Furrowlink fleet starts dropping packets from tractors in the Dunmore test field. Turns out the ingest buffer filled up after the morning firmware push doubled report frequency and nobody bumped the queue size. On-call bounced the gateway at 14:35, which bought us twenty minutes before it filled again. Real fix was rolling the buffer config forward at 15:10. If this recurs, check buffer depth first, then confirm you're on the patched build via the token below.

pipeline stamp: htk6_7941f2

Ticket: Config drift on PickWise optimizer nodes

For the release manager: the pick-list optimizer in the Haverton warehouse cluster has drifted from the baseline we cut for release 4.2. Two nodes carry hand-edited batching weights from last month's peak-season tuning, which were never merged back. Route scoring now differs between nodes by up to 6%. We should reconcile before Friday's freeze. The intended baseline configuration is reproduced below for comparison.

settings of yaguf-bahip:
druwyn:
  log_level: debug
  metrics_host: metrics.druwyn.qorvelsys.internal
  pool_size: 32